Cleveland Air Show – September 4, 2023

On Labor Day weekend, the Cleveland Air show took flight! As one of the country’s oldest and most esteemed annual air shows, the Cleveland National Air Show boasts a rich history, spanning from the National Air Races of 1929-1949 to the present-day Air Show since 1964. This year, GVIS joined the excitement, proudly showcasing a dazzling array of visualizations crafted within our lab.

Aviation Day – September 13, 2023

Cleveland hosted NASA Aviation Day on September 13, which was a free event open to the public. This event showcased various aviation projects, including the Quesst mission, electrified aircraft propulsion, and sustainable aviation technologies. Attendees explored NASA-devolved technology and interacted with displays.  Additionally, there were informative panel sessions that shed light on NASA’s efforts to advance commercial air travel, making this event beneficial for individuals, students, and professionals, alike.
